On-Ear Headphones
On-ear headphones are light-weight and usually more portable than their over-ear counterparts. They fit casual listeners who desire a balance in between sound quality and mobility. Brands like Beats and Bose offer numerous engaging alternatives in this category.
In-Ear Headphones
In-ear headphones, commonly referred to as earbuds, are highly portable and frequently included active noise cancellation features. They are preferred by users who choose a compact design, making them simple to carry around. Brands such as Apple's AirPods and Samsung's Galaxy Buds are particularly popular in the UK.
Wireless Headphones
The shift to wireless headphones has become a substantial pattern over the past few years. Bluetooth technology has actually made it exceptionally simple to enjoy music without being constrained by wires. Premium options from brands like Sony and Jabra deal excellent battery life and sound quality.
Noise-Cancelling Headphones
Noise-cancelling headphones are increasingly preferred, specifically by regular visitors. These headphones can substantially improve the listening experience by minimizing background noise. Brands like Bose and Sony lead this specific niche, supplying exceptional products for those seeking harmony in loud environments.
Sports Headphones
Sports headphones are customized for active people. They typically come with sweat-resistant features and a comfy fit to remain in place during exercises. Brands such as JBL and Jaybird style headphones that cater particularly to physical fitness lovers.
Current Trends in the UK Headphone Market
The headphone market in the UK is ever-evolving, affected by technological improvements and consumer need. Some existing trends include:
Increased Demand for Wireless Models: With smart devices removing headphone jacks, consumers are gravitating towards wireless choices for greater convenience.Modification and Personalization: Many brands are now using adjustable noise profiles, enabling users to customize their listening experience.Focus on Sustainability: A growing number of brand names are dedicating to eco-friendly practices, creating products from recycled materials and using sustainable packaging.Integration of Smart Features: Features like voice assistants and touch controls are becoming requirement in many contemporary headphones.Considerations When Buying Headphones

Are noise-cancelling headphones worth it?
Yes, specifically for frequent travellers or those who work in noisy environments. They boost the listening experience by considerably reducing background noise.
What should I think about when buying wireless headphones?
Aspects to consider consist of battery life, Bluetooth variety, comfort, and sound quality. Ensure they match your desired use, whether casual listening or active movement.
Can I utilize headphones while working out?
Absolutely, however it's a good idea to choose sports headphones designed for this function. They normally provide better fit and are sweat-resistant.
